A significant security breach has shaken the decentralized finance ecosystem, with LayerZero publicly attributing a $290 million exploit to Kelp's Designated Validator Network (DVN) setup. The incident has raised critical questions about protocol liability, security standards, and investor protection mechanisms across interconnected DeFi platforms. As the market digests the fallout, stakeholders are demanding clarity on which protocol will ultimately shoulder the financial burden of the losses.
The exploit represents one of the larger security incidents in recent DeFi history, underscoring the ongoing tension between innovation speed and robust security frameworks. With Aave users among those affected by the losses, institutional and retail investors alike are reassessing their exposure to cross-protocol dependencies and the adequacy of current risk management practices in the broader ecosystem.
Understanding the LayerZero-Kelp Configuration Breach
LayerZero operates as a messaging protocol that enables interoperability between different blockchain networks. The protocol's security relies partly on its Designated Validator Network (DVN) infrastructure, which validates cross-chain transactions. According to LayerZero's statement, the configuration implemented by Kelp—a liquid restaking platform—created a vulnerability that attackers successfully exploited.
Kelp's specific setup of the DVN validators apparently contained a flaw or oversight that allowed bad actors to circumvent normal security procedures. This configuration issue highlights a critical concern in DeFi architecture: the security of interconnected systems depends not only on the primary protocol but also on how secondary protocols integrate with and configure these core components. The $290 million figure represents a substantial loss that raises questions about whether either party had adequate safeguards or audit procedures before deployment.
The nature of the exploit underscores a fundamental challenge in DeFi: as protocols become more interconnected to offer enhanced functionality and user liquidity opportunities, the attack surface expands proportionally. A misconfiguration in one protocol can cascade across multiple platforms, affecting users who may not have directly interacted with the vulnerable component.
Market Implications and Protocol Accountability Questions
The most pressing question emerging from this incident is: who bears financial responsibility? LayerZero's attribution of fault to Kelp's DVN setup suggests that LayerZero may be positioning itself as having fulfilled its obligations and placing liability with Kelp. However, the broader market is questioning whether LayerZero should have provided stronger guidance, safeguards, or validation requirements before allowing such configurations.
Aave, which appears to have users affected by the exploit, finds itself in a delicate position. The leading lending protocol's reputation depends partly on the security of underlying infrastructure it integrates with. While Aave itself was not the direct target, the association with losses raises questions about the due diligence DeFi platforms conduct when selecting infrastructure partners and integrations.
This incident follows a pattern of security breaches that have collectively cost the DeFi ecosystem billions in losses over the past several years. Unlike traditional finance, where institutional safeguards and regulatory frameworks often distribute liability clearly, DeFi operates in a gray zone where smart contract code is considered law, yet community and protocol governance must determine responsibility retroactively.
Market sentiment toward cross-chain bridges and messaging protocols has historically been volatile due to past exploits. This LayerZero incident may further pressure users to reconsider their exposure to these infrastructure layers, potentially slowing adoption of multichain strategies among cautious investors.
Investor Implications and Risk Assessment Going Forward
For investors currently positioned in DeFi protocols, this incident presents a sobering reminder about systemic risk. Even when investing in established platforms like Aave, exposure to security vulnerabilities in upstream or integrated protocols remains a concern. The $290 million exploit represents real capital loss for real users, many of whom may not have fully understood the technical dependencies their investments carried.
Going forward, sophisticated investors are likely to conduct deeper due diligence on:
- The security audit history of protocols their chosen platforms integrate with
- The technical configuration requirements and whether these have been independently verified
- The governance frameworks for disaster recovery and loss compensation
- Insurance and safety fund mechanisms available through platforms
The question of whether any party will step up to cover the shortfall remains unanswered. If LayerZero declines responsibility and Kelp lacks sufficient resources or insurance, the loss may fall entirely on affected users. This outcome would reinforce the understanding that in DeFi, users ultimately bear protocol risk regardless of which entity maintained the vulnerable infrastructure.
Protocol teams may respond to this incident by implementing stricter governance over external integrations, requiring additional security audits before new configurations launch, and establishing clearer liability frameworks. However, given DeFi's decentralized and often anonymous nature, enforcement remains challenging.
Additionally, this incident may accelerate interest in alternative solutions such as redundant validator networks, insurance protocols, and more transparent security frameworks. Some users may also reassess their allocation between DeFi yield opportunities and the actual risk-adjusted returns once protocol security incidents are factored in.
